Chicken Vermicelli Recipe

Chicken Vermicelli

Graham

Recipe by  

Chicken Vermicelli Soup is probably the easiest soup you'll ever make since it takes only three minutes to cook and the ingredients are few and readily available. Having said that, it's tasty and filling and is great for a quick snack or light lunch.

Vermicelli is a spaghetti-type pasta though much smaller - diameter less than 0.06 inches (1.5 mm) whereas spaghetti has diameter between 0.06 and 0.11 inches (1.5 and 2.8 mm). Vermicelli means "little worms" in Italian. It is known as seviyen in the Indian subcontinent.

      Preparation Time: 4 Minutes

      Cooking Time: 3 Minutes

Ingredients for Chicken Vermicelli

If you are not familiar with any ingredients, please check our International Cooking Terms page.
US Imperial Measurements  UK Imperial Measurements  Metric Measurements

Currently displaying quantities in US Imperial Measurements
to serve 2:
4 oz
dried Vermicelli
2
chicken stock cubes
 
salt
1¾ pints
water

 

How to Cook Chicken Vermicelli

  1. Boil the water in a kettle then transfer it to a saucepan. Dissolve the stock cubes in the water and bring it back to the boil. Add the Vermicelli and salt to taste and stir occasionally during the 3 minutes cooking. Serve in soup bowls for a quick and filling snack or light meal.


Graham GRAHAM'S HOT TIP:
Chicken Vermicelli Soup is delicious eaten with slices of hot buttered toast
